Operator Regression Testing

Blacksite editor operators and modal tools must preserve the authored scene across preview, commit, cancellation, validation failure, and undo/redo. Tests share operators::test_harness::OperatorInvariantHarness so a new tool proves the same contract instead of inventing local assertions.

Required invariants

Every production operator test must cover the paths it exposes:

Path Required proof
Commit Expected authored projection, exact undo-group delta, dirty state, stable operator ID, committed phase
Zero-history commit Authored projection and prior dirty state remain unchanged
Cancel or commit failure Exact authored projection restored, no new history, prior dirty state, stable operator ID, terminal canceled/blocked phase
Blocked start Commit closure never runs; authored state, history, and dirty state are unchanged
Preview failure Cancel finalizer runs, authored state is restored, and helpers are removed
Preview helpers No helper component remains after commit or cancel
Undoable commit assert_undo_redo_round_trip restores both initial and committed semantic projections
Continuous edit The entire interaction creates one history command, not one per frame or target

The harness intentionally fails with the invariant name in the assertion message. Tests may add domain assertions, but should not replace these shared lifecycle checks.

Adding a tool test

  1. Build a minimal World with ActiveOperator, EditorHistory, and SceneIo. Add tool-specific selection/resources and SelectedEntity when history helpers update selection.
  2. Capture OperatorInvariantHarness immediately before starting the operation.
  3. Run the real dispatch path or production finalizer used by the input system. Do not duplicate its state transition in the test.
  4. Call assert_committed, assert_canceled, or assert_blocked with the expected authored and undo deltas, then assert_status with the stable operator ID and terminal phase.
  5. For helpers, call assert_no_helpers::<ToolHelper>. For undoable work, project the meaningful state through assert_undo_redo_round_trip; use assert_projection_unchanged for no-op paths.

Do not satisfy a lifecycle test by constructing an EditorCommand and checking only its label. The test must mutate a world and prove restoration.

Current coverage

Workflow Coverage
Generic EditorOperator Commit cleanup, preview/commit failure rollback, blocked no-op, terminal ID/phase
Palette and registered commands Typed immediate commit versus modal preview ownership; failed CSG start terminates
Selection and scene commands Atomic Group Selection across repeated undo/redo; grouped Reset Lighting and Project Sun history
Asset workflows Asset/sub-asset placement; material/texture group assignment; audio/animation assignment and incompatible targets
Viewport material drop Exact renderer slot/primitive/brush-face preview, cancel, commit, cleanup, undo, and redo
Draw Brush and CSG Modal cancel; decomposed commit; CSG validation/read-only block, cancel, grouped commit, and deleted-brush restoration
Brush clip and element gizmo Production finalizers, geometry round trip, Escape rollback, and helper cleanup
Terrain sculpt and paint Multi-dab grouped commit, no-op release, commit failure rollback, cancel, clean-view interruption, and resource cleanup
Physics placement Prerequisite block, no-op commit, exact cancel, real settle commit, multi-selection grouping, helper cleanup, undo, and redo
Transform gizmo finalization Actual tracker finalizer, continuous multi-target grouping, no-op release, and missing-primary survivor rollback

The shared harness covers formal operators and multi-frame modal paths. Atomic inspector and history mutations that do not own ActiveOperator use focused typed history tests with equivalent semantic projection and undo/redo assertions.
